WebTheatre emerged in different societies worldwide from myth and ritual, storytelling, imitation and fantasy. [1] In the West, the origins of theatre are usually located in the rituals and myths of Ancient Greece. According to Aristotle’s Poetics theatre is rooted in the pagan rituals to honor god Dionysus in Greece. WebThis is an excerpt from Beginning Musical Theatre Dance With Web Resource by Diana Dart Harris. The first dramas that included music and dance were presented by the Greeks in the 5th century BCE. Those dramas served as models for the Romans, who expanded the dance element. During the Middle Ages, groups of traveling actors used dance to tell ... Web15 aug. 2024 · Jazz dance in the early years of musical theatre. Jazz dance first found its way into American musical theatre in the 1920s with the advent of the “ Harlem Renaissance”. This was a period of time when African American culture, art, and music were celebrated and given a platform to be seen and heard on a larger scale.
